Men's Basketball 2010 District Champions

Men's Basketball District Champs!
2/14/2010

Men's Basketball (23-5) took to the floor on Saturday night knowing they were playing for a championship in arguably the states toughest basketball district.  As been the theme all tournament the Panthers used suffocating defense and relentless hustle to gain a 58-41 victory over tournament host Wekiva. In the first half the game's momentum swung back and forth with each team keeping things close. Damani Cade put down a monster dunk with seconds left in the first quarter to put the Panthers ahead 15-11.  Quarter two saw much of the same action as DP outscored the Mustangs by two points to take a 24-18 lead going into the half.

As the third quarter fired up so did the Panther defense, only allowing Wekiva to score nine points.  "Like we've said all tournament defense and rebounding has been the key" said head coach Anthony Long.  Although the Panther's outside shooting game went unusually cold, they took to the boards and paint and  physically outplayed the Mustangs inside. Wekiva tried to post a valiant comeback in the fourth quarter but DP was just to much and cruised to the 58-41 victory.

Damani Cade was the difference maker on Saturday night with 13 points, 11 rebounds, four assists, three steals, and two blocks.  Pat Ryan led all scorers with 15 points and nine rebounds.  Shane Larkin had 13 points and five rebound and Kirby Lubin continued his great play with 11 points, eight rebounds, and seven steals.  Keenan Green and Chris Thomas performed awesome in the paint stifling the tough Mustang inside game. 

The win marks the program's third district title in four years and guarantees a home playoff match up against Treasure Coast next Thursday in the 'House of Payne' starting at 7 p.m.
